William has been furious with his brother over a series of perceived attacks against the royal family since Harry and his wife, Meghan Markle, the Duke and Duchess of Sussex, quit as active royals in 2020. That includes Harryâs 2023 memoir Spare.
Among the bookâs bombshells was Harryâs claim that William knocked him âto the floorâ during a fight about Markle, leaving Harry with âscrapes and bruises.â Harry claimed William described Meghan as âdifficult,â ârude,â and âabrasive.â
William was âabsolutely horrifiedâ by Harryâs claims in the book, according to Us Weekly, which quoted a royal source as saying William âdoesnât even recognize his own brother anymore.â
Kate didnât entirely escape criticism in Spare, as Harry wrote that the princess made Markle cry just days before her wedding. Nevertheless, Harry called Kate the âsister I never hadâ in the memoir.
Prince Harry sat a few rows behind Prince William, Princess Kate, and two of their children during King Charlesâ coronation in May.
The last time Harry was with the royal family was during his fatherâs coronation in May, but he didnât interact with his brother and sister-in-law, nor with King Charles or Queen Camilla. Harry and Meghan werenât invited to an upcoming royal family gathering at Balmoral to mark a year since the death of Harryâs grandmother, Queen Elizabeth II.
During a January interview, Harry expressed hope at âbeing able to find peaceâ with William some day, adding: âMy brother and I love each other. I love him deeply. There has been a lot of pain between the two of us, especially the last six years.â
